Ohio State University libraries
The Ohio State University Libraries are the collective libraries of the Ohio State University and its satellite campuses.

Empirical Musicology Review is a peer-reviewed open-access academic journal concerned with empirical musicology. It was established in 2006 and is published by the Ohio State University Libraries. The editors-in-chief are Daniel Müllensiefen and Daniel Shanahan. David Butler was the founding editor.[1]
